Abi Ratoff (South 2017) is an illustrator based in Horsham and London. After leaving Cranleigh she did a foundation degree in Design and Applied Arts at Oxford Brooks followed by a degree in Illustration at University of the West of England. She now works mainly in digital illustration and design and her work is brightly coloured and bold, demonstrating her love for pattern and playfulness.

Abi is also an experienced print-maker and painter and having worked on the art production teams from Standon Calling and Boardmasters festivals, would like to branch into murals/set design and painting at festivals. Abi’s work will be on sale at the Crafty Fox Market on 6 November and 3 December in London SE1, and the Guildford Indoor Christmas Market on 16 December.
